Abstract

The present invention relates to an ink-jet coating device for manufacturing a display panel. The ink-jet coating device for manufacturing a display panel is composed of a basal plate, a plurality of ink guns and a cleaning device, wherein the ink guns can adjust the slope angle, the ink in the ink guns can be simultaneously jetted onto the basal plate by the cleaning device, the basal plate can be fixed and can also move, the number of the ink guns can be 1 to 100 according to required mould plates, a nozzle plate rack of the ink guns corresponds to the pitch of the mould plates and is parallel to the mould plates, and the nozzle plate rack can tilt with any angle. The present invention has the advantage that the ink-jet printing principle is smartly used for the manufacture procedure of the display panel so as to simplify the procedure. Accordingly, the present invention saves the expense. Besides the color filtering procedure of the display panel, the present invention also has the advantages of coating fluorescent object to form an electrode and a line interval, etc. which are suitable for all the procedures of the ink-jet.

Background technology
At present, under the situation that the demand with the high-grade grade headed by the digital TV, big frame TV is improved all the more, display, LCD, plasma display plate (PDP) wait the exploitation of carrying out respective display in each field of display.
The CRT that the former display that is used as TV extensively is employed has advantage with its resolution and image quality aspect and becomes their principal item.CRT often is called kinescope in the modern information display.But concerning the giant display and high-resolution TV that increase gradually, with it is the CRT of big weight, large volume, need urgently especially than it much thin and light high briliancy, high efficiency, high-resolution, high-speed responsive characteristic, the life-span is long, driving voltage is low, the exploitation that consumes the panchromatic flat-panel monitor that electric power is low, price is low.
FPD in developing and producing has: LCD LCD, OEL, inorganic EL, FED, plasma display panel PDP, electric ink etc.
Seize with technology in the war of occupation rate of market at this, not only, also pour into very big effort realizing low priceization to realizing high performance.So the exploitation of the screen print process of alternative original one-tenth main flow and the low price operation of photolithography operation is constantly presenting the achievement that makes new advances.
The screen print process is the short-cut method that operation is simple, use the low price equipment.But because of the lack of homogeneity of thickness and width is not suitable for being applied to high meticulous place.And the photolithography operation is thickness and has good uniformity, and can form film, thereby can adapt to the meticulous requirement of height, but it has the valency height, loss is many and manufacturing process is complicated and needs to use the shortcoming of equipment at high price.
Because of these reasons, ink jet printing method is can be used for various occasions with it, and device is concentrated and the operation expense is low and be subjected to gazing at of common people recently.
Its scope of application is: to for the operation that forms the FPD template all can be suitable for, the particularly formation of coloured filter, forms electrode, is formed with in the field such as electricity layer and is employed widely the formation of curtain, fluorophor dorsad.

The specific embodiment
Fig. 1 is used to make the side view of the ink jet type apparatus for coating of display board according to the present invention for expression.
As shown in Figure 1, the ink-jet coating apparatus of making display board according to the present invention be by substrate 3, can regulate the inclination angle a plurality of ink guns 7, clean can be constituted in the above-mentioned ink gun 7 to the cleaning device 6 that substrate 3 sprays ink simultaneously.
Above-mentioned a plurality of ink gun 7 be by nozzle grillage 5 when carrying out printing process, can either be mounted to fixedly, also can be mounted to movable type, can load onto 1~100 ink gun according to the required template of user, so just can finish flow process quickly.
In addition, aforesaid substrate 3 is can fix after rail 4 is installed on the rotary disk 2 of support substrate 3 and the transfer device 1 or move, and cleaning device 6 also can move simultaneously.
Fig. 2 is used to make the precedence diagram of treatment process of the ink-jet coating apparatus of display board for the present invention.
A plurality of ink guns and dress ink (S1) are installed among Fig. 2 as can be known.
Clean the nozzle face (S2) of mounted ink gun then, and come into line the position (S3) of nozzle.
After the said nozzle positional alignment is neat on X-Y platform installation base plate (S4).
Then, after aforesaid substrate installs (S4),, carry out ink jet printing (S6) then, again with regard to close examination template (S7), operation after the post processing again the substrate discharging neat (S5) of laying.
Fig. 3 is used for making a plurality of ink gun luffing structure of the ink-jet coating apparatus figure of display board for the present invention.
As can be known, each shower nozzle can both carry out pitching and take corresponding to the pitch of desired template in a plurality of ink guns among Fig. 3.Storehouse because all ink guns are finished with a flow process quickly, is arranged so can press correct interval for corresponding each resolution for this.
If this device can be applied to PDP, the making of the R of LCD etc., G, B colour transition filter plate just can be various types of by R, G, B, and the ink gun of three populations is installed.
In this ink gun, install ink, and with whole nozzles by the cleaning device 6 of last Fig. 1 and be ready to spray, if this moment, the words that not mobile cleaning device 6 but ink gun 7 are moving, just the fluctuation of the ink face that is injected by plastic tube causes spraying bad result, so Zhuan Zhi formation just becomes the appearance as Fig. 1 as mentioned above.
Fig. 4 is used to guarantee the television camera pie graph of accurate position for the present invention.
As shown in Figure 4, when substrate is installed, for forming correct template, must be the nozzle of ink gun and substrate marshalling.1CCD camera on Fig. 4 and two in 2CCD camera are with a method of top nozzle alignment, accomplish to make ink to be ejected on the correct position.In order to confirm all a plurality of heads, make and to move automatically.
In addition, a 3CCD phase group of planes being installed is in order to guarantee the accuracy of position under situation about loading continuously on the substrate at every turn.
Fig. 5 is real-time injection monitor spraying system figure of the present invention.
As shown in Figure 5, in case guarantee the position, the ink that is sprayed by ink gun forms template on substrate, and this moment is for guaranteeing that qualification rate must have real-time monitoring system.
And the CCD camera among Fig. 5 is an injection action of confirming the nozzle of each ink gun to watch-dog.
Fig. 6 is a false template flow diagram of the present invention.
The feature of ink gun injection action as shown in Figure 6 is, carries out compared with injection, and it is more that unusual disease takes place during injection beginning.Therefore need false template operation.If can accomplish template earlier, at first to monitoring conveniently, and because provide the signal spacing earlier can for ink gun, thereby can offer help to the formation of creation meniscus.
Fig. 7 is examined the schematic diagram of state for ink discharge device of the present invention.
As shown in Figure 7, move to next operation after the substrate of finishing the template operation finally is examined, this operation is if resemble red, green, blue colour transition filter disc production process at that rate, and the track of this equipment is connected to baking box with row formula ground always.
Fig. 8 is used to make the 1st embodiment schematic diagram of the ink-jet coating apparatus of display board for the present invention.And Fig. 9 is used to make ink-jet coating apparatus the 2nd embodiment schematic diagram of display board for the present invention.
As Fig. 8 and shown in Figure 9, it is that expression is produced the head unit system that uses injection apparatus in batches as exploitation, and its 1st embodiment is cut apart head fixed head 9 fixing, and its 2nd examples of implementation are for to be fixed on head fixed head 9 on the axle.
The all fixed axis of fixing head and fix each head holder 8 not only can be adjusted each axle respectively, and the angle that can regulate each fixed axis.
This system can once be ejected into all places of plate face, and can shorten activity time.
